1.
To attain a Certificate IV in E-Business, ten (10) units must be achieved.
Learners to complete a minimum of five (5) units from the E-Business field listed below.

2.
A minimum of 2 Business Services Training Package units, and 3 units from the Business Services training Package or any other endorsed Training Package, of which a minimum of 2 units must be from a qualification at Certificate IV, and 1 unit may be included from a lower or higher level in this qualification. There are over 100 units available in the Business Services Training package at Certificate IV, allowing exceptionally high levels of flexibility in responding to particular business needs.
